And, while some of the criticism of Sam Darnold may be warranted, Super Bowl history is littered with QBs who didn't light up the scoreboard but still came away with championships. Matter of fact, ever seen the list of Super Bowl winning QBs who didn't even throw a TD pass?

Namath SB3, Griese SB8, McMahon SB20, Aikman SB28, Elway SB32, Roethlisberger SB40, Peyton Manning SB 50, Brady SB53.
